Ecotricity is Britain's greenest energy company. When we started back in 1995, we were the first company in the world to provide a new kind of electricity- the green kind.

Our mission was, and remains, to change the way energy is made and used in Britain- by replacing fossil fuels with clean, renewable energy.

We don't just supply green energy, we use the money from our customers' bills to make it ourselves too- we build windmills and sun parks in Britain. We call this 'bills in to mills'. In 2021, we started work on building two new solar parks, and now, in 2024, we're bringing geothermal energy to our customers' fuel mix, a first in the UK. We're also developing green gas mills which will generate 100% green gas from a source that we will never run out of- grass.

We don't just focus on energy though- we built Electric Highways, Britain's leading network of electric vehicle charging points, we helped Forest Green Rovers become the greenest football club in the world, and, in partnership with RSPB, we launched Britain's greenest mobile phone service, Ecotalk.
